eSeminar: Construction of Quantum Codes using Constacyclic Codes

Talk by Habibul Islam

There are several convenient ways to construct quantum codes from classical codes, the CSS and Hermitian construction are two popular among them. Here, we describe how classical (particularly, constacyclic) codes have been successfully producing new and better quantum codes under these constructions. First, we implement the idea over finite fields and then extend to non-commutative rings followed by commutative rings. From an application point of view, many quantum codes outperforming the best-known codes are constructed.
